首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何为Angular 4+选择多行KendoUI网格并将其移动到另一个kendoUI网格

为Angular 4+选择多行KendoUI网格并将其移动到另一个KendoUI网格,可以通过以下步骤实现:

  1. 首先,确保已经安装了KendoUI库,并在Angular项目中引入了所需的KendoUI模块。
  2. 在组件的HTML模板中,使用KendoUI网格组件来展示数据。为了支持多行选择,需要将selectable属性设置为"multiple"
代码语言:txt
复制
<kendo-grid [data]="gridData" selectable="multiple">
  <!-- 网格列定义 -->
</kendo-grid>
  1. 在组件的TypeScript代码中,定义一个变量来存储选中的行数据。使用KendoUI网格的selectionChange事件来监听选择变化,并将选中的行数据存储到变量中。
代码语言:txt
复制
import { GridComponent, GridDataResult, SelectableSettings } from '@progress/kendo-angular-grid';

// ...

export class YourComponent {
  public gridData: GridDataResult;
  public selectedRows: any[] = [];

  public onSelectionChange(selection: SelectableSettings): void {
    this.selectedRows = selection.selectedRows;
  }
}
  1. 在另一个KendoUI网格中,使用[data]属性绑定另一个数据集,并使用[selectedKeys]属性绑定选中的行数据。
代码语言:txt
复制
<kendo-grid [data]="anotherGridData" [selectedKeys]="selectedRows">
  <!-- 网格列定义 -->
</kendo-grid>

通过以上步骤,你可以实现在Angular 4+中选择多行KendoUI网格,并将其移动到另一个KendoUI网格中。请注意,以上代码示例中的gridDataanotherGridData需要根据实际情况进行替换,以适应你的数据源。

关于KendoUI网格的更多信息和使用方法,你可以参考腾讯云的KendoUI产品介绍页面:KendoUI产品介绍

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• 业界 | 百度IDL最新成果:从自然语言入手,教AI智能体像人类一样学习

    尽管人工智能取得了巨大的进步,但在许多方面仍然存在局限。例如,在电脑游戏中,如果AI智能体未预先编程游戏规则,则必须尝试数百万次才能确定正确的选择。人类可以在更短的时间内完成相同的壮举,因为我们擅长通过使用语言将过去的知识转移到新的任务中。 在一个屠龙游戏中,AI智能体需要尝试许多其他的动作(对着墙或是花丛喷火),才能理解它必须杀死龙。然而,如果AI智能体理解语言,人类可以简单地使用语言来指示它:“杀死龙才能使游戏获胜”。 在人类如何概括技能并将其应用于新任务方面上,基于视觉的语言发挥着重要作用,这对于机器

    010

    百度IDL最新成果:从自然语言入手,教AI智能体像人类一样学习

    尽管人工智能取得了巨大的进步,但在许多方面仍然存在局限。例如,在电脑游戏中,如果AI智能体未预先编程游戏规则,则必须尝试数百万次才能确定正确的选择。人类可以在更短的时间内完成相同的壮举,因为我们擅长通过使用语言将过去的知识转移到新的任务中。 在一个屠龙游戏中,AI智能体需要尝试许多其他的动作(对着墙或是花丛喷火),才能理解它必须杀死龙。然而,如果AI智能体理解语言,人类可以简单地使用语言来指示它:“杀死龙才能使游戏获胜”。 在人类如何概括技能并将其应用于新任务方面上,基于视觉的语言发挥着重要作用,这对于机器

    06
    领券